Output 20620d50a03656c0ae445b11b2809ddcad8519d8868521d4810fd591b3c991d1:32

value
21118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b8685743250af0ba6b34782536f57d390c2d01 OP_EQUAL
address
3EFDQgrP67uyjnuFmYvXrmBdprFGmYL582
transaction
20620d50a03656c0ae445b11b2809ddcad8519d8868521d4810fd591b3c991d1